The size of Dandenong is approximately 11.3 square kilometres. There are 22 parks, covering nearly 16.6% of the total area. The population of Dandenong in 2016 was 29906 people. By 2021 the population was 30127 showing a population growth of 0.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Dandenong is 30-39 years. Households in Dandenong are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Dandenong work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 43.10% of the homes in Dandenong were owner-occupied compared with 39.70% in 2016.
